Transaction 5458422ff8b1b5d4a6990a6737ce7be7314bbc131eface95234b211062d84b1b
1 Input
1 Output
-
5458422ff8b1b5d4a6990a6737ce7be7314bbc131eface95234b211062d84b1b:0
- value
- 43759656
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bd8feedb0c9d645f9d3f77169f99e97d65b2b0f
- address
- bc1q30v0amdse8tyt7wn7ackn7v7jlt9k2c0m34h3w